Solana Mobile confirms 1.8 billion SKR token airdrop for Seeker phone users

Solana Mobile users and app developers would be eligible to receive a share of roughly 2 billion Seeker tokens following the conclusion of Season 1 of the SKR airdrop.

Summary

  • Solana users will receive a combined 1.8 billion SKR tokens in the first Seeker airdrop on Jan. 21.
  • Airdrop rewards are based on user engagement and follow a five-tier structure, with the highest tier offering 750,000 SKR tokens.

Slated for Jan. 21, over 100,000 users and 188 developers will be rewarded a total allocation of 1,819,755,000 SKR and 141,030,000 SKR, respectively, Solana Mobile wrote in a Wednesday X post. 

An allocation tracker, now live, will allow users to check how much they will receive directly from their “seed vault wallets.”

SKR is the native token of the Solana Mobile ecosystem and is tied to the second generation of smartphones launched by Solana Mobile last year. It will serve as the foundational utility and governance token that is expected to grant users more control over platform policies and governance. 

Seeker users will also be able to delegate their tokens to Guardians, who are responsible for verifying devices, curating apps, and enforcing community rules. Users will be eligible for various exclusive in-app features and staking rewards.

According to tokenomics unveiled earlier this month, SKR has a total supply of 10 billion tokens, of which 30% has been reserved for community airdrops. Out of this, two-thirds of the initial airdrop allocation has been earmarked for Solana Seeker users and developers.

Another 2.7 billion SKR that will be unlocked during the token generation event will be allocated toward the community treasury, liquidity provision, and growth and partnership initiatives.

Starting Jan. 21, Solana Mobile users will be able to stake and start earning rewards for their tokens through Guardians directly via the Seed Vault Wallet.

“SKR can also be staked on the web via the SKR Staking web experience,” Solana Mobile added.

Seeker phone owners are eligible to earn a maximum of 750,000 SKR based on a tier system that Solana Mobile said was “determined by engagement with Seeker, the Solana dApp Store, and on-chain activity,” during season 1 of the airdrop.

There are currently five tiers, namely Scout, Prospector, Vanguard, Luminary, and Sovereign, with Sovereign being the highest and Scout on the lower end, with a reward of 5,000 SKR.

Seeker is the second-generation device in Solana Mobile’s crypto-integrated smartphone lineup that began shipping to over 50 countries in August last year. While the previous iteration of the phone, dubbed Saga, failed to gain traction, Seeker has witnessed stronger uptake thanks to improved hardware and a more affordable $500 price point.

When shipping began, Solana Mobile had reportedly secured over 150,000 pre-orders.

Topline The Federal Reserve on Wednesday opted to ease interest rates for the first time in months, leading the way for potentially lower mortgage rates, bond yields and a likely boost to cryptocurrency over the coming weeks. Average long-term mortgage rates dropped to their lowest levels in months ahead of the central bank’s policy shift. Copyright{2018} The Associated Press. All rights reserved. Key Facts The central bank’s policymaking panel voted this week to lower interest rates, which have sat between 4.25% and 4.5% since December, to a new range of 4% and 4.25%. How Will Lower Interest Rates Impact Mortgage Rates? Mortgage rates tend to fall before and during a period of interest rate cuts: The average 30-year fixed-rate mortgage dropped to 6.35% from 6.5% last week, the lowest level since October 2024, mortgage buyer Freddie Mac reported. Borrowing costs on 15-year fixed-rate mortgages also dropped to 5.5% from 5.6% as they neared the year-ago rate of 5.27%. When the Federal Reserve lowered the funds rate to between 0% and 0.25% during the pandemic, 30-year mortgage rates hit record lows between 2.7% and 3% by the end of 2020, according to data published by Freddie Mac. Consumers who refinanced their mortgages in 2020 saved about $5.3 billion annually as rates dropped, according to the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au. Similarly, mortgage rates spiked around 7% as interest rates were hiked in 2022 and 2023, though mortgage rates appeared to react within weeks of the Fed opting to cut or raise rates. How Do Treasury Bonds Respond To Lower Interest Rates? Long-term Treasury yields are more directly influenced by interest rates, as lower rates tend to result in lower yields. Key Takeaways BitGo has launched regulated trading services in Europe after receiving approval from German regulator BaFin. The new service offers European institutions a platform that combines asset custody, trade execution, and aggregated liquidity. BitGo launched regulated trading services for European institutions today, following approval from German financial regulator BaFin. The digital asset infrastructure company now offers European institutional clients access to trading services that combine custody, execution and aggregated liquidity. BitGo Europe said the platform provides infrastructure for institutional participation in digital asset markets. The services target European institutions seeking regulated access to crypto trading through a single platform that integrates multiple functions including asset custody and trade execution.
